FUROSHIKI WORKSHOP WITH TATIANA ARAZAKI

In this workshop, Tatiana Arazaki, founder of the TATINOTABI (“Tati’s journey”) project, invites you to discover the traditional Japanese art of Furoshiki—a sustainable and elegant fabric wrapping technique that has been used in Japan for centuries.

Through different folding and knotting techniques, you will learn how to: wrap gifts creatively, create reusable bags, carry everyday objects in style, and reduce your use of paper and plastic.

OMAMORI WORKSHOP WITH YUKARI MIYANO

Discover the meaning and tradition behind Omamori, Japanese amulets that protect their wearers and help make wishes come true.

In this workshop led by Yukari Miyano, you will be able to create your own traditional Japanese amulet, choosing from a variety of beautiful Japanese fabrics. With needle and thread, you will sew your Omamori, add a cord, and finish with a small decoration of your choice.
